STUDENT PRICING
All Meals are Free for the 2025-2026 school year.

Adult Pricing:
Lunch: $6.00
Breakfast: $3.50
Snack: $2.50
Fact! Whole Grains reduce the risks of heart disease, stroke, cancer, diabetes and obesity.
Fact! Whole grains have some valuable antioxidants not found in fruits and vegetables, as well as B vitamins, vitamin E, magnesium, iron and fiber.
Fact! Whole Foods are an excellent source of calcium, fiber, B vitamins, magnesium, protein, Vitamin D, essential fatty acids, and potassium.
Fact! Whole Foods typically contain fewer calories and more nutrients than other foods.
